How are whipped cream and haddock different?

  • Whipped cream is richer in vitamin A and calcium, while haddock is higher in vitamin B12, selenium, phosphorus, vitamin B3, vitamin B6, and choline.
  • Haddock covers your daily need for vitamin B12, 77% more than whipped cream.
  • Whipped cream contains 125 times more saturated fat than haddock. Whipped cream contains 13.831g of saturated fat, while haddock contains 0.111g.
  • Whipped cream has a higher glycemic index (55) than haddock (0).

Cream, whipped, cream topping, pressurized and Fish, haddock, cooked, dry heat types were used in this article.
